Area of Science:

  • Microsurgery
  • Reconstructive Surgery
  • Tissue Transplantation

Context:

  • Abdominal wall and contents serve as donor sites for tissue reconstruction.
  • Microsurgical techniques allow versatile application of abdominal tissues in various body parts, especially craniofacial areas.
  • Over 110 digestive free transplants were utilized in head and neck repairs over an 8-year period.

Purpose:

  • To demonstrate the optimal utilization of anatomical and physiological properties of diverse abdominal tissues for reconstructive purposes.
  • To explore novel therapeutic strategies by combining abdominal tissue transplants with other repair techniques.
  • To highlight the potential of abdominal tissues as an inexhaustible source for reconstructive transplantation.

Summary:

  • Abdominal tissues are valuable donor sites for reconstructive surgery, particularly in head and neck defects.
  • Microsurgical expertise extends their application to diverse anatomical regions, including the craniofacial area.
  • Advanced techniques like chimerical and double flaps offer comprehensive tissue replacement in single operative sessions.

Impact:

  • Abdominal tissue transplantation provides versatile and abundant reconstructive options.
  • The integration of various repair techniques enhances therapeutic possibilities in complex reconstructions.
  • Microsurgical applications of abdominal tissues expand reconstructive potential, addressing diverse surgical challenges.
